Conda 更新 Python 好慢
如果你在使用 Conda 来管理你的 Python 环境,并且发现更新 Python 版本的速度很慢,这篇文章将会给你一些解决方法和优化建议。
问题描述
当我们使用 Conda 来更新 Python 版本时,有时候会遇到非常慢的情况。这可能是由于 Conda 的默认源速度较慢,或者是网络连接不稳定所致。
解决方法
方法一:更改 Conda 源为国内镜像源
Conda 是一个开源软件包管理系统和环境管理系统,它使用源来下载和安装软件包。由于 Conda 的默认源可能位于国外,对于国内用户而言,访问速度可能较慢。
为了解决这个问题,我们可以将 Conda 的源更改为国内的镜像源,以加快下载速度。以下是更改源的步骤:
- 打开终端或命令提示符。
- 输入以下命令,编辑 Conda 的配置文件:
conda config --set show_channel_urls yes
conda config --add channels conda-forge
这些命令将在 Conda 的配置文件中添加 conda-forge 镜像源。
- 输入以下命令,将 Conda 源更改为国内镜像源:
conda config --add channels
conda config --add channels
这些命令将把 Conda 的源更改为清华大学镜像源。
- 输入以下命令,检查 Conda 的源是否已成功更改:
conda config --show channels
如果显示的源包含 conda-forge 和清华大学镜像源,则说明更改成功。
方法二:使用清华大学镜像源安装 Python
如果你只是想直接安装一个特定版本的 Python,而不是更新现有的 Python 环境,你可以使用清华大学镜像源来下载和安装 Python。
- 打开终端或命令提示符。
- 输入以下命令,下载并安装指定版本的 Python:
conda install python=3.8
这个命令将下载并安装 Python 3.8 版本。
方法三:使用 pip 来更新 Python
除了使用 Conda 来更新 Python,另一个选择是使用 pip 工具来更新 Python。以下是使用 pip 的步骤:
- 打开终端或命令提示符。
- 输入以下命令,升级 pip 工具:
pip install --upgrade pip
- 输入以下命令,使用 pip 来更新 Python:
pip install --upgrade python
这将会下载并安装 Python 的最新版本。
优化建议
除了以上的解决方法,还有一些优化建议可以帮助你加快 Conda 更新 Python 的速度:
-
使用稳定的网络连接:确保你的网络连接稳定,并且没有被限制或阻塞。
-
使用代理服务器:如果你在使用 Conda 的过程中经常遇到速度慢的问题,可以尝试使用代理服务器来加速下载。
-
使用高速镜像源:除了清华大学镜像源,还有其他一些高速镜像源,比如中科大镜像源等。你可以尝试使用这些镜像源来提高下载速度。
总结
Conda 是一个功能强大的软件包管理系统,可以帮助我们轻松地管理和更新 Python 环境。当我们遇到 Conda 更新 Python 版本速度慢的问题时,可以通过更改镜像源、使用 pip、优化网络连接等方法来解决问题。
希望本文能帮助到你,让你更好地使用 Conda 更新 Python!
参考链接
- [Conda documentation](
- [清华大学开源软件镜像站](